6.1
About RS-232C
You can connect a controller (i.e. PC and PLC) to the RS-232 interface using Applent
RS-232 DB-9 cable. The serial port uses the transmit (TXD), receive (RXD) and signal
ground (GND) lines of the RS-232 standard. It does not use the hardware handshaking
lines CTS and RTS.
NOTE:
JUST ONLY Use an Applent (not null modem) DB-9 cable.
Cable length should not exceed 2m.

Make sure the controller you connect to AT861x also uses these settings.
The RS-232 interface transfers data using:
8 data bits,
1 stop bit,
And no parity.
